What Causes Teeth to Change Color?
Many factors contribute to tooth discoloration, some of which are temporary and can be fixed with good dental hygiene, while others are the result of irreversible changes that can be treated at Locust Valley Dentistry.
Foods and Drinks
Perhaps the most common cause of tooth discoloration is pigments found in certain food products and drinks. The most notorious tooth stainers are coffee, red wine, and tea. Tooth whitening is often very successful at whitening teeth stained by your diet, but cutting back on these beverages and using good oral hygiene can also help bring back a pearly shine to your enamel.
Smoking
Tobacco use will gradually darken and yellow teeth because of two active ingredients: tar and nicotine. Tar is a black substance that stains the enamel, and nicotine reacts with oxygen to create a yellowish compound. Tooth bleaching using treatments that include hydrogen peroxide can help break down these stains and make your smile whiter.
Age
Beneath the hard, white exterior of the tooth, the enamel, lies a softer, yellower substance called dentin. As people age, the enamel is gradually worn down due to brushing and other wear and tear, revealing more of the yellowish dentin.
Injury
If you’re ever hit in the mouth, one side effect could be tooth discoloration. One way your body heals and protects teeth is by adding dentin, which is a darker, yellower color than the enamel that overlays it. More dentin, therefore, comes with yellower teeth.
Medications
Certain prescription drugs, like blood pressure medicine, antihistamines, and antipsychotic drugs can have the side effects of darkening teeth. Radiation and chemotherapy can also have this effect.
What to Expect From the Tooth Whitening Process
When you visit Locust Valley Dental for tooth whitening, you’ll first be evaluated by Dr. Koster, who will determine if your tooth staining or discoloration is extrinsic, meaning on the outside of the tooth, or intrinsic, caused by the internal structures of the teeth. Next, she’ll choose the appropriate teeth whitening option best suited for your unique condition, whether ZOOM gel or take-home trays or both.
Before beginning the tooth whitening process, Dr. Koster will clean and polish your teeth to remove any superficial debris and staining. If using ZOOM gel, the procedure will then take place in the office. If using whitening trays, Dr. Koster will take an impression of your teeth and explain the process thoroughly for you to perform in the comfort of your own home.

ZOOM In-Office Whitening
This approach uses the highly effective ZOOM whitening gel to clean and de-stain your teeth. A high-tech laser activates the gel once it’s applied to the teeth and accelerates the whitening process. All told, expect your ZOOM in-office whitening appointment to take about 90 minutes. You’ll see an increase of several shades of whiteness after your first treatment and, if needed, additional treatments can create even more dramatic results.
Custom Take-Home Whitening Trays
Unlike one-size-fits-all whitening strips, our custom trays are made just for you. This perfect fit ensures the trays are comfortable and that the whitening gel sits snugly against your teeth. The results are even, consistent, and amazing. Wear your trays as instructed by Dr. Koster and you’ll see gradual results after several days of use. At-home whitening also offers an effective way to maintain the whiteness of your teeth following an in-office whitening treatment or just as a whitening procedure that can be done in the comfort of your home.
